Let me start by saying that I KNOW this is all easier said than done. Being a mother does not mean sacrificing yourself as a woman. We do not not lose our identity in motherhood our identity evolves. Let me also argue that being a woman first is also being a mother first because YOUR CHILD deserves you at your best. Here are ways I intentionally pour into myself and I know my child thanks me for it because he deserves for me to show up whole.

  1. WASH YOUR ASS. Before you were a mother a shower was not some luxury you indulged yourself in every once in a while. It was a basic necessity and the bare minimum of taking care of yourself. IT IS NO DIFFERENT NOW! Hygiene is a non negotiable. Being clean is not something to sacrifice.

  2. EAT for crying out loud!!! Would you hop in your car for a road trip with your tank on E?? FUCK NO you wouldn’t because you don’t want to end up broke down on the side of the road wishing you never cancelled that AAA membership. Food is your fuel and it also a NON Negotiable. Hold yourself accountable and fuel your body

  3. EXERCISE I’m not saying you need to become a gym rat. I’m not saying start cross country or body building but GIRL…please move your body. Find a 15-20 min video and promise yourself you’ll finish it no matter how many times you pause it. During nap time don’t you dare wash those dishes or fold that laundry stretch, do yoga, meditate, or dance.

  4. When you look in the mirror compliment yourself. LOVE what you see stop with the negative self talk. YOU are BADASS. WE are ever EVERYTHING to these tiny humans and we owe it to them to not talk down on ourselves. We are just as great as they see us. We are EVERYTHING.

  5. GRACE…One day at a time. Just one day at a time. Remember take it ONE DAY AT A TIME!
